Cold-rolled formed engineering solutions are making waves in the mining industry by reducing waste generation by up to 80% compared to conventional methods. Santosh Venkatasubbaiah, Director of Sales and Marketing at Mother India Forming, emphasizes that traditional fabrication methods create inefficiencies through cutting and welding, leading to unnecessary costs. Cold roll forming minimizes material loss and delivers precision-engineered profiles, which are crucial for enhancing productivity and sustainability in mining operations. This method not only supports India's green steel initiatives but also offers improved corrosion resistance, resulting in longer service life and decreased replacement frequency. Experts estimate that maintenance costs in mining can account for 20-50% of total operating costs, with cold-rolled formed components potentially lowering these costs by 10-20%. Pavan Kaushik, Co-founder of Gurukshetra Consultancy, notes that the move towards precision-engineered systems is a structural shift that can lead to significant cost savings and improved safety. As the mining sector continues to evolve, cold roll forming is positioned as a critical lever for enhancing efficiency and sustainability.
